Ordinals
beta
Address 1DTiVHj661ZTBspmDUkpAq1bZDR9Gp6ztc
sat balance
1202735
runes balances
outputs
6a8c9a81b8f64a5ceccba48ffe3b2c3d4258f55232f397d8280102dda993b5dc:28